Sarah Hayley Orrantia
Sarah Hayley Orrantia was born on 21 February 1994. She is an American singer and actress. Her most well-known character is that of Erica Goldberg in the ABC comedy show The Goldbergs. She was a member Lakoda Rayne during The X Factor's initial season. In 2015, she released "Love Sick" her first single. The debut EP, The Way Out, was released in May 2019. Orrantia started singing at the age of nine and started professionally training at the age 12. She composed her first song when she was 13. By 15, she had recorded her first EP of cover songs and began writing with songwriter Jamie Houston who at the time was famous for writing hits for three Disney High School Musical movies. Orrantia was chosen to take part in the auditions for The X Factor's first season during the summer of 2011. Orrantia was chosen from the submissions on YouTube submission , and received four votes of approval from the judges during the live auditions in Seattle. She initially auditioned as a soloist and was not selected for the show, however during Hollywood Week she and three other female singers were placed in a group to continue the auditions. They were then eliminated from live shows during the fifth week.
